Breaking Down the Process: A Closer Look at Human Verification Steps

The question begs: why does a simple instruction like “Press & Hold to confirm you are a human” matter so much? To answer this, we need to take a closer look at the layers of security and logic that underpin these practices.

At its most basic level, digital verification is a tool designed to weed out automated systems. However, the process involves multiple fine points that are both technologically sophisticated and accessible enough for everyday users. Consider the following breakdown:

Step Description Importance
User Prompt A message instructs the user to “Press & Hold,” ensuring active intervention. Initiates the verification process and sets the stage for further security checks.
Time-Based Check The duration of the button press indicates genuine human activity. Prevents quick-fire automated scripts from bypassing the checkpoint.
Secondary Validation Sometimes paired with additional tests like pattern matching or token generation. Offers a multi-layered security approach against sophisticated bots.

In industries such as financial services or e-commerce, where every second and every data point can translate into significant monetary value, the extra step of confirming human intent is well worth the minor inconvenience. This multi-step process helps cut through the overwhelming number of automated attacks and ensures a reliable digital transaction experience.
